Just swap in a entire motor/tranny/t-case set up. If you run a manual NP 241 or electronic NP 246 you will have a drivers side front drop. Which is what you have. Then you will have a VSS from the t-case to run the PCM but maintain your rear axle sensor to operate your speedo.
